Question : The least value of $\tan^2x+\cot^2x$ is:
Option 1: 3
Option 2: 2
Option 3: 0
Option 4: 1
Correct Answer: 2
Solution :
The value will be minimum when $x = 45°$
Minimum value $= \tan^2x+\cot^2x=\tan^245°+\cot^245°=1+1=2$
Hence, the correct answer is 2.
